mstpXstPortRegionalBridge
Module: FORCE10-MSTP-MIB
OID (symbolic): FORCE10-MSTP-MIB::mstpXstPortRegionalBridge
OID (numeric): 1.3.6.1.4.1.6027.20.2.14.1.8
Node type: OBJECT-TYPE
Type: BridgeId
Access: read-only
Description: .
What is mstpXstPortRegionalBridge?
This read-only OID reports the regional root bridge ID as seen through this port. Admins use it to confirm which region the neighbor attached to this port believes it belongs to, useful when hunting down a region-boundary misconfiguration.
Examples
Walk all instances (SNMPv2c):
snmpwalk -v2c -c public <target> 1.3.6.1.4.1.6027.20.2.14.1.8 snmpwalk -v2c -c public <target> FORCE10-MSTP-MIB::mstpXstPortRegionalBridge
Get a specific instance (index 1):
snmpget -v2c -c public <target> 1.3.6.1.4.1.6027.20.2.14.1.8.1 snmpget -v2c -c public <target> FORCE10-MSTP-MIB::mstpXstPortRegionalBridge.1
